CATALOG

这套方案的核心思路是:用芯步的人体传感器感知会议室使用状态,用其API触发您的业务系统(软件项目),再由业务系统调用音柱的HTTP接口进行语音播报。整个链路中,芯步不直接控制音柱,而是作为“感知神经”,您的软件项目负责“大脑决策”。

1. 项目概述与业务目标

在现代智能办公环境中,会议室资源的管理效率直接影响企业运营成本。针对“会议室预约状态语音提示”这一场景,本方案的目标是解决两大痛点:

  1. 资源占用冲突:未预约团队占用已预约会议室,导致秩序混乱。

  2. 空间闲置浪费:预约者迟到或未到导致会议室空置,他人却不知情。

本方案的核心目标是将60W物联网语音广播音柱(作为执行终端)与现有的会议室预约系统(软件项目) 深度集成。通过在会议室门口部署音柱,实现无人值守的自动化语音播报,如提醒当前会议主题、提示未预约人员离开或提醒会议即将结束。

2. 系统设计

本方案基于“云-管-边-端”的物联网架构理念,结合芯步开放的API能力进行设计。

2.1 架构层级

  • 感知层 :部署芯步相关传感器(如红外/雷达人体传感器,用于检测室内是否有人),实时采集会议室占用状态。

  • 执行层 :60W IP网络音柱。负责接收并播放语音内容。

  • 传输层 :企业内部局域网或WiFi(优先有线网络以保证音频流稳定)。

  • 平台层 :芯步开放平台与用户自建的预约系统服务器。

    • 芯步侧:处理设备连接、状态上报、指令转发

    • 业务侧:处理预约逻辑、人员权限、TTS(文字转语音)生成。

2.2 数据流向逻辑

  1. 用户在小程序/Web端预约会议室 \rightarrow 数据写入业务服务器。

  2. 预约时间临近 \rightarrow 业务服务器触发指令 \rightarrow 调用芯步API \rightarrow 音柱播报“会议即将开始”。

  3. 传感器检测到无人但系统显示已预约 \rightarrow 业务服务器接收到“无人”状态 \rightarrow 自动释放资源或通过音柱提醒。

3. 硬件选型与接口分析

为了实现上述逻辑,需正确配置以下关键硬件及其接口能力:

3.1 60W物联网语音广播音柱

虽然不同厂商(如世邦、TP-LINK等)的音柱在物理形态上各有特点,但在物联网集成视角下,我们关注的是其通用的网络控制接口

  • 关键接口能力

    • 控制协议:支持TCP/IP、UDP、HTTP协议。

    • 音频源:支持TTS(文字转语音) 或预录的MP3文件播放。

    • 触发方式:支持通过HTTP API调用,携带参数(如音量、播放次数、播放URL)。

    • 集成要点:音柱需静态IP地址,业务系统需直接调用音柱的API或通过中间件(如NBS服务)调用。如果是第三方品牌,需要确保其提供二次开发接口(SDK/API)

3.2 芯步传感器(辅助逻辑)

为了达到“智能”且避免机械执行,搭配传感器实现闭环:

  • 智能人体存在雷达传感器:用于判断会议室真实是否有人。若预约时间已到但无人,可触发语音提示“检测到无人,如无需使用请在APP释放资源”,以此提升流转率

  • 接口机制:传感器通过事件上报机制向您的服务器推送数据。您的服务器需接收这些radar_enable有人/无人的状态值,用于逻辑判断。

4. 软件项目对接技术实现

本方案假设您的软件项目(Java/Node.js/Python等)已具备会议室预约管理功能,现重点说明如何接入音柱设备。

4.1 设备注册与网络配置

  • 获取凭证:在芯步开发者后台获取AppIdAppSecret

  • 设备ID绑定:将60W音柱注册到平台,获得唯一的Device ID。将音柱与会议室物理位置进行绑定(如:ID:1001对应第一会议室)。

4.2 核心接口调用逻辑

芯步的接口调用机制采用签名验证,保证安全性。核心请求格式如下:

  • 请求地址http(s)://api.thingboot.com/{AppId}/device/control/

  • 鉴权参数sign(签名) 和 ts(时间戳)。

  • 关键命令(以Node.js示意):

注:具体命令字段需参考芯步针对该型号音柱的设备文档,不同类型的音柱order参数可能不同(如有的需要传音频URL)

4.3 场景触发器设计

在您的软件项目中设置以下触发器:

  1. 预约成功触发器:当系统新增预约时,调用API让音柱短鸣一声或播报“已预约”,确认设备在线。

  2. 时序触发器(关键)

    • 会前5分钟:播报提醒。

    • 会时0分钟(迟到检测) :结合人体传感器判断。如果传感器上报“无人”,系统自动通过音柱播报:“预约人未到场,当前会议室空闲,如需使用请扫码续用”。

    • 会时结束前:播报“时间即将结束,请整理离开”。

5. 典型场景工作流程演示

以下是一个典型的“非预约入侵检测与语音驱离”全流程:

  1. 状态感知:某员工推门进入会议室,但并未在系统预约当前时段。

  2. 数据上报:安装在会议室内的芯步人体传感器检测到人员移动,通过HTTP推送将{"status":"active"}发送到您的业务服务器

  3. 逻辑判断:您的业务服务器查询数据库,发现该时段无预约记录(或状态为占用但实际无关联人员)。

  4. 指令下发

    • 业务服务器拼接TTS文本:“友情提示,本会议室当前未被预约,如需使用请打开手机软件扫码登记,10秒后将广播通知行政。”

    • 通过芯步API向设备ID=音柱下发play_tts命令

  5. 终端执行:音柱接收到数据包,解码后通过60W功放进行高分贝播报。

  6. 结果闭环:如用户扫码登记成功,系统播报“预约成功,祝您会议愉快”;如未登记,可设定循环播报或通知管理员。

6. 实施难点与优化

6.1 网络延迟与音频质量

  • 问题:60W音柱通常用于较大空间,若使用WiFi可能不稳定。

  • 方案:优先采用有线网络接口接入音柱。在核心交换机上为此类物联网终端划分独立VLAN,确保带宽,全链路音频传输延迟应控制在30ms以内以获得良好体验

6.2 TTS合成的时效性

  • 问题:实时TTS合成再推送,可能造成几秒的延迟。

  • 优化:对于固定场景(如“请勿占用”),预先生成MP3文件存储在音柱本地存储或服务器。API仅下发文件索引播放指令,而非长文本,以此减少网络传输量

6.3 对接异构系统

  • 如果您的软件项目并非从头开发,而是使用了钉钉/飞书会议室套件,可以利用芯步的开放能力,编写一个轻量级的中间件服务(Webhook Receiver),专门负责监听飞书/钉钉的回调事件,并转换为芯步的控制指令

7. 总结

通过将60W物联网语音广播音柱接入基于芯步API的软件项目,您不仅解决了传统会议室仅靠屏幕显示通知的盲区(视觉死角),还利用传感器实现了“预约-感知-播报-处置”的业务闭环。该方案的实施关键在于理解芯步统一的HTTP API调用规范以及根据会议室场景逻辑定义清晰的时序触发器

语音播报器产品方案:
怎样二次开发智能 20W 远程控制语音音柱来实现多设备语音同步播报
查看 >>
酒店前台入住引导语音提示场景:怎样将智能语音通知台卡对接到自己的项目中
查看 >>
怎样对接15W 语音播报壁挂音箱以实现多设备语音同步播报
查看 >>
怎么在前台语音提醒中对接智能设备来实现云端文本转语音播报
查看 >>
共享棋牌室服务台语音通知场景:怎么将10W 语音提醒通知音柱接入到自己的项目中
查看 >>
会议室场景方案:
怎样在会议室预约签到语音提示场景中接入智能硬件以实现设备状态语音反馈
查看 >>
会议室门禁控制:如何把智能门禁墙壁开关集成到自己的项目中
查看 >>
会议室语音提醒:怎样将10W HTTP 接口语音壁挂音箱集成到自己的项目中
查看 >>
会议室预约状态语音提示场景:怎么把40W 远程控制户外防水壁挂音箱集成到自己的项目中
查看 >>
如何在会议室预约状态语音提示场景中集成智能硬件来实现语音通知推送
查看 >>
预约用途方案:
会议室预约状态语音提示场景:如何将30W 智慧园区语音终端音柱对接到项目中
查看 >>
图书馆自习室座位预约语音通知场景:怎样把20W壁挂语音提醒音箱接入到软件项目中
查看 >>
图书馆自习室座位预约语音通知场景:怎样将40W室内壁挂语音提示音箱接入到软件项目中
查看 >>
共享台球室叫号预约提示场景:怎么把40W 定时语音播报壁挂音箱对接到项目中
查看 >>
如何在共享台球室叫号预约提示场景中接入智能硬件以实现远程 TTS 语音播报
查看 >>